When addressing cracks, using high-quality fillers that are specifically designed for outdoor use is critical. These fillers not only seal the crack but also expand and contract with temperature changes, preventing new cracks from forming. Be sure to read labels carefully to select products that are suitable for your specific patio typ


Evaluating your patio's slope is essential; it should ideally direct water away from your home. If your patio is flat or sloped towards your house, consider grading it properly. This may involve excavation and the addition of materials to create the correct slope, ensuring that water flows away from your foundation and minimizes the risk of flooding.

Teak wood is another popular choice for outdoor furniture due to its natural oils that resist water and deter insects. However, it requires regular maintenance, including oiling, to preserve its appearance and durability. Homeowners should assess their willingness to maintain the furniture and choose materials that fit their lifestyl
